Merge 5.10.194 into android12-5.10-lts
Changes in 5.10.194 module: Expose module_init_layout_section() arm64: module-plts: inline linux/moduleloader.h arm64: module: Use module_init_layout_section() to spot init sections ARM: module: Use module_init_layout_section() to spot init sections mhi: pci_generic: Fix implicit conversion warning Revert "drm/amdgpu: install stub fence into potential unused fence pointers" Revert "MIPS: Alchemy: fix dbdma2" rcu: Prevent expedited GP from enabling tick on offline CPU rcu-tasks: Fix IPI failure handling in trc_wait_for_one_reader rcu-tasks: Wait for trc_read_check_handler() IPIs rcu-tasks: Add trc_inspect_reader() checks for exiting critical section Linux 5.10.194 Change-Id: I1e4230071f3ca3c9e811aeba31446875028d7b3d Signed-off-by: Greg Kroah-Hartman <gregkh@google.com>
